Marketing in Tourism and Hospitality Course No: 513 Nature of the Course: Marketing in Tourism and Hospitality (MHM) Credit Hours: 3 Objectives The objective of this course is to provide understanding with knowledge and skills in order to take decision in the of tourism and hospitality marketing Contents
Chapter-1 1.0Introduction to Hospitality and Tourism Marketing 1.1 Meaning and Concept of Hospitality and Tourism Marketing 1.2 Marketing Management Philosophies 1.3 Importance of Marketing in Hospitality and Tourism Industry 1.4 Special characteristics of Hospitality and Tourism 1.5 Marketing Fundamentals of Hospitality and Tourism Industry 1.6 Core Principles of Marketing
Chapter-3 3.0 The Hospitality and Tourism Marketing Environment and their impact 3.1 Internal Environment 3.2 Micro environment 3.3 Macro Environment
Chapter-4 Consumer Behaviour Meaning and Concept A model of consumer behaviour Factors Influencing consumer's buying behaviour Buying Decision Process of individual customers Organizational buying decision process
Chapter-4 Marketing Information System and Research The Marketing Information System Source of Marketing Information Marketing Research Requirements of research process Steps involved in research process
Chapter-5 Service characteristics of hospitality and tourism marketing Understanding Service marketing How is service marketing different? Contextual and Generic differences Different marketing approach needed for Hospitality and Tourism Marketing
Chapter-6 Analyzing Marketing Opportunities Understanding Situation analysis Advantages of conducting situation analysis Steps involved in a situation analysis
Chapter-7 Marketing Strategies: Segmentation, Targeting and Positioning Market segmentation and its benefits Criteria for effective segmentation bases Target Marketing and Marketing Mix Market Positioning and strategies
Chapter-8 Marketing Plan and the Eight Ps Marketing plan and its objectives Benefits of a marketing plan Foundations and requirements of an effective marketing plan The eight Ps of hospitality and travel planning Steps involved in planning process
Chapter-9 Product Development Strategies Levels of Products Augmented Products: Product/Service mix Branding New Product Development Alternative Strategies for Product Life Cycle Stages Relationship and Partnership Marketing Customer Value and Satisfaction Retaining Customers
Chapter-10 Pricing Products Factors to consider when setting prices General Pricing approaches Pricing Strategies Price Changes
Chapter-11 Distribution Channels Nature and Importance of Distribution System Marketing Intermediaries Establishing Distribution Mix
Chapter-12 Communication and Promotional Policy What is promotion and communication? Goals and Objectives of promotion The communication process Communication Budgeting Promotional Mix Major Tools for Promotion Managing and Coordinating Integrated Marketing Communications Process
Chapter-13 Public Relations and Sales Promotion Major Activities of PR Departments Publicity and Public Relations Process Major Tools for Marketing PR Public Relations Opportunities for Hospitality Industry Crisis Management Sales Promotion
Chapter-14 Electronic Marketing Internet Marketing E-Commerce Database development Direct Marketing
Chapter-15 Destination Marketing Globalization of the Hospitality and Tourism Industry Importance of Hospitality and Tourism to a Destination's Economy Strategies for Destination marketing Functions of NTO
Chapter-16 People service and service quality The importance of service quality Total quality management Measuring service quality
Chapter-17 Tourism Packaging and Programming Role of packaging and programming in marketing Packaging concepts offered by the industry Relationship of packaging and programming
Basic Books: 1. Marketing for Hospitality and Tourism, 3rd Edition by Philip Kotler, John Bowen and James Makens. 2. Hospitality and Travel Marketing, 2nd Edition by Alastair M. Morrison.
